Description Morten Welinder 2004-10-29 03:08:10 UTC
The help menu could have a submenu linking to help for the functions
that are actually used in the current sheet.  That would typically
not be very many and thus easy to navigate.

It would need to be populated upon actication.
Comment 1 Jody Goldberg 2004-10-29 04:22:01 UTC
I'm not sure that it would be a small number or that we'd want to do it on
activation.  For a large sheet the iteration could be expensive.
